Would not recommend this burger joint unless you have a lot of time to spare and are willing to deal with random levels of service. My experience here was less than ideal and the food was to match. The place was a mess to say the very least. My order was a Chapli Kebab Burger combo with curly fries. As you can see in my picture I was not given any curly fries on my to-go order. The experience is what really gave this place its infamous place in my review. I walked into this establishment at 12:07 PM and was the first in line. Behind me, a rushed woman carrying a large thermos with a pump. I assumed she worked here and she went around me and greeted the employee as the woman who works next door and needed 7 cups of chai. I would assume any normal employee would have said something to the tune of, "Sure, but let me get to your after I help this gentleman at the front of the line." But no, she proceeded to debate the actual volume of the thermos and what the cost will be. I sat there for another 3 minutes before she was done with the thermos lady. The cashier then greets A DIFFERENT customer on the other side of the front where another register is and my jaw drops at the audacity of this server/hostess. I was finally greeted by another employee coming from the kitchen who mumbled everything she said quietly so I had to ask her to repeat herself multiple times before I made my order for the chapli burger and fries. I proceed to sit down and note that it is exactly 12:12 PM. I can see the kitchen was busy filling a very large catering order but it appeared as for in-house customers, I was 2nd in line. After 30 minutes a staff member notices I have no food and thinks I'm the catering order waiting to pick up where he finds out that I have been waiting for 30 minutes. Unfortunately, I was needed back at work by 1PM and told him that if the food wasn't out by 12:45, I'd need to leave so it may be best to cancel the order. He rushes to the kitchen to find out what was the hold up where after 3 minutes, I walk to the front and ask for a refund. The lady server goes and checks on the food and the two staff members then inform me that the burger has been done for little, but they didn't have any fries so they were starting a new batch and they asked me to wait. I refused and said I needed to leave immediately as my lunch was shortly coming to an end. They said, it would be "on the house", which it wasn't as they didn't refund my money. I was dumbfounded by the staff's shortcoming but this was most likely no one individual's fault. I was handed a bag which felt EXTREMELY light for what I ordered, to which I found there were no fries. I got home and took a bite out of the "burger" to find a mouth full of unfitting flavors. This was an indo-pak'esk kebab dressed (barely) as a burger. The flavors weren't bad alone, but together, wasn't an ideal meal. The sweet flavors of the grilled bun didn't pair well with the savory and spicy flavors of cultural seasonings. The burger was dry for the most part and really needed some vegetation to compliment the kebab. A light padding of lettuce would of done the trick. I couldn't finish it as my first bite had what was either the driest piece of fennel I've seen or a stem from some veggie that was definitely not in my burger. I found hard bits of what seemed to be beef cartilage. But it was large enough to make me not want to finish it and gave me an unpleasant experience with the burger's texture.

Buckle up for a little POV ft. My time trying this restaurant. I ordered lahori fish, in store. The online menu showed it as an entree, but the cashier stated it was an appetizer so I figured and clarified, it would be fish only. Which I was fine with. He said it would be 15-20 mins. About 12 mins later, I head back inside to pickup my food. The cashier recognized me, grabbed my food off the main counter by the registers then handed it to me. I skedaddle on my way. Literally as I am opening my car door which was a ways from the front door due to it being crowded, the cashier appears, hurriedly requesting that I check my food. So I open the bag to see fish. I figured ā€œok?? what’s going onā€ so then another guy comes to hand me another bag of food which I peek into and it looks similar* to the order I was holding. Turns out, the skimpy, nearly cold, dusty-crusty plate was the ā€œmealā€ I was about to take home. (should’ve checked before I left) He stated ā€œthey only put a little in thereā€ and handed me a fresh plate that was scolding hot and heavier. There was also fries which I was not expecting nor did I want. It’s giving possible racism with a dash of ā€œwas this food already eaten?ā€ I requested sauce with the fish while placing the order and was told no as I stared at sauce in the fridge. Honestly, the fish wasn’t bad but it s no surprise I shall never return.

This is not a burger place 🤣🤣 I walked in very confused if I was to sit at a table or order at the counter. Most tables have table cloths with an assigned number. Everything looks clean and proper. I went to the counter looking for a menu and found a decent selection of Indian food items. I asked if there was a burger menu and I was shown the list of 7-8 burger choices. I selected the Del Rio Jungle Burger, fries, and drink….. plus tip….. $14.62… sounds like a good deal…. Someone came in after me and ordered some Indian food and was served in about 15 minutes. I went back to the counter to ask about my burger and was told it’s almost done. The burger came out after about 5-7 minutes later. It was not what I ordered but I was ready to eat. The guy that served the burger said the fries would be out in just a minute. I finished my burger and a few minutes later the guy came out back to tell me they didn’t have any fries šŸ¤£šŸ¤£šŸ¤£ā€¦ā€¦ I told them that was fine and they brought me $3.00 to cover the cost. Please don’t come here for a burger 🤣
